trans_proxy是一款用Rust编写的透明代理工具,支持macOS和Linux,能够自动拦截并转发流量。它恢复原始目的地址,内置DNS转发器,支持DNS-over-HTTPS,有效解决DNS污染问题。用户只需设置网关和DNS,无需安装软件,适用于多种设备。
最近发现了一款名为dae的透明代理,基于Linux eBPF技术,性能优于传统代理。其配置简单,适合路由器和树莓派,但对内核版本有要求。安装过程顺利,支持日志查看和分流规则设置,整体体验良好。
透明代理是网络编程的基础项目,核心在于将客户端数据转发至服务器。设计中维护两个连接,利用bufferevent实现双向转发和流量控制,以防内存溢出。该项目为负载均衡器和SOCKS5代理奠定基础。
本文记录了作者在前端静态服务透明代理方面的探索,介绍了从Nginx到http-server,再到更轻量的dufs和static-website的工具使用及镜像大小变化,最终实现了92k的小镜像,满足静态代理需求。
本文介绍了如何使用树莓派Zero2W和USB Key搭建便携式旁路由,重点在于实现透明代理,满足小巧、Wi-Fi连接和网络切换的需求。通过配置SD卡和USB直连,用户可轻松连接树莓派并进行网络设置,最终实现便携式网络代理功能。
本文探讨了如何利用海外VPS搭建HTTP代理服务以绕过国内访问限制。作者通过Python脚本测试代理可用性,发现直接访问VPS失败,但透明代理成功。分析得知是GFW的深度包检测所致。最终,作者结合使用sing-box和Clash,实现了透明代理,简化了网络访问,提升了开发体验。
透明代理在用户与网站之间充当中介,提升网络性能和安全性。它们无需用户设置,适合企业进行身份验证、负载均衡、缓存加速和内容监控。尽管存在隐私和网络依赖风险,透明代理仍是优化网络管理的重要工具。
最近,使用机场、v2raya和GFWList的全局透明代理效果最佳。推荐Nexitally机场,节点多且延迟低。ArchLinux可通过命令一键安装v2raya,并在浏览器配置分流规则,以确保微信正常启动,避免DNS请求过多的问题。手机端使用v2rayNG客户端,导入Shadowsocks订阅地址即可。
本文讲解如何在Linux上使用iptables的TPROXY功能实现透明代理TCP和UDP流量。首先,设置支持UDP Associate的SOCKS5代理服务器。接着,使用如redsocks或hev-socks5-tproxy等软件,将SOCKS5代理转换为支持TCP和UDP的透明代理。通过配置iptables和iproute2,可以代理来自其他设备或本地的流量。需要注意的是,ufw防火墙可能会阻止TPROXY数据包,需进行额外配置。此外,还可以通过uid-owner等选项为特定应用程序设置代理。
R2S是一款低功耗、双千兆以太网口、价格实惠的迷你Arm服务器。它可以作为透明代理智能网关使用,配备Armbian Linux系统。本文提供了在R2S上设置Armbian、配置宽带拨号、DNS解析和透明代理的教程。还包括安装必要软件和设置iptables进行流量路由的说明。
Spotify在中国被墙,可以使用软路由、透明代理或车机上的surfboard来解决。桌面端可以设置socks5代理,但移动端没有。通过安装surfboard和导入配置文件可以在车机上实现使用。配置规则后可以成功使用Spotify。
TProxy是一种透明代理方式,通过替换数据包的socket实现伪装发送和接收数据。利用netfilter hook和iptables socket规则可以优化性能。
TProxy(透明代理)是Linux内核支持的一种代理方式,允许在不修改数据包头的情况下重定向流量。通过IP_TRANSPARENT选项,socket可以伪装成非本机地址。使用iptables TPROXY扩展,可以指定重定向目标,并通过策略路由确保数据包被正确处理。TProxy的核心逻辑在于根据数据包的五元组匹配相应的socket,实现高效的流量管理。
完成下面两步后,将自动完成登录并继续当前操作。